Requirements

  • Ability to work independently.
  • High School diploma / GED equivalent.
  • Basic trouble shooting skills.
  • Mechanical knowledge and understanding of machinery
  • Good organizational skills with ability to complete multiple tasks simultaneously.
  • Ability to lift 50 pounds at a minimum of 15 times per shift.
  • Ability to climb on and off a forklift safely and without assistance occasionally.
  • Ability to safely operate a forklift in high traffic, low clearance areas while not posing a safety risk to others.
  • Must not be at risk of sudden alterations in consciousness.
  • Hearing sufficient to recognize and respond to shouted warnings alarms and horns on forklifts.
  • Verbal communication adequate to use a radio and or paging system to contact other co-workers in other areas of the complex.
  • Able to use both hands for effective manipulation of tools/parts.
  • Ability to climb ladders / steps.
  • Ability to push/pull loads of approx 50 lbs at a minimum of 10 time per day/shift.
  • Stereoptic vision of 20/40 or better and peripheral vision of 70 degrees or greater and ability to read 10-12 point font at a distance of 12-18
  • Color vision within normal limits (according to Ishihara screen).
  • Able to stand/walk for 7 hours of an 8-hour shift.

Responsibilities

  • Run quality tubes with minimal scrap.
  • Setup and operate forming machines
  • Setup and operate tube layer packer.
  • Perform daily checks and functions to keep the equipment in running condition.
  • Read a production schedule and determine orders to be run.
  • Maintain work area in a clean and orderly fashion.
  • Remove scrap from production area
  • Maintain and enforce all company safety, environmental and department of health requirements.
